The Madonna of the Goldfinch
by Gloria J. Viglione©

Composure
is her strength

the way she tends
to matters on the inside, how

she presents him
to the daylight,

the songbird, docile
in his tiny clutch

his mouth sounding the language
of the owl and the finch

his gaze dreaming the path
the butterfly takes in winter.

The Madonna
cradles a secret

while the infant holds firmly
to her veil

inviting peek-a-boo
with the whole world.
